In this podcast, I brush across a variety of concepts and information related to the hypothesis of "body weight set point" that espouses the idea that the body sticks to roughly the same set point in body weight when we attempt to change our weight, the body fights against that imposed change - why? What mechanisms and reasons might there be? Is there a better theory?
